Number of up-down permutations p of [n] such that for all i<n-1 the number of elements p(j) between p(i) and p(i+1) for j>i+1 differs from the number of elements p(k) between p(i+1) and p(i+2) for k>i+2.

Terms
- a(0) =1a(1) =1a(2) =1a(3) =1a(4) =2a(5) =4a(6) =11a(7) =37a(8) =147a(9) =684a(10) =3611a(11) =21345a(12) =139794a(13) =1004293a(14) =7853728a(15) =66413562a(16) =603851552a(17) =5874507617a(18) =60886603188a(19) =669797203196
